I was on a mission to see what I could find in the macro world this morning, first stop was the bathroom and in looking out my window I was amazed by the ice crystals, I have all ways been attracted to the sparkles with the bright prism colors of the rainbow, but have never been able to capture them with my camera, I think they exceed the dynamic range of most sensors. Anyway I digress, but I did find this amazing abstract miniature ice shelf complete with a awesome shadow and drops of water showing there beautiful surface tension. It has sense melted, it had a very short life but I have recorded record of it’s beautiful existence.

There’s no Exif data in the image so for all the pixel peepers here it is:

Nikon D300, 105mm f/2.8 VR Macro lens shot at 1/125 sec at f/16, Iso 200 and processed with  Adobe Lightroom 2 with the added touch of Tony Sweets secret weapon, I can’t tell you what that is or I have to kill you.
